Energy Efficiency That Pays Off Over Time
Managing heat and glare is a year-round concern in Tampa’s warm climate. Shutters help create a thermal barrier between your interior and the outdoors, making them a cost-effective, energy-efficient choice. Closed louvers can keep rooms cooler during hot afternoons, easing the load on your AC and trimming your monthly utility bills.
That added insulation can also be a welcome bonus during the occasional cold snap, keeping your bedroom cozy and comfortable regardless of the season.

Durability That Makes a Difference
Built to Last, Not Just to Look Good
High-quality shutters are made from durable materials that can withstand daily use, moisture, and exposure to sunlight, which is especially important in humid areas like South Tampa or Clearwater. Unlike fabric-based coverings that may fade, fray, or require replacement over time, shutters hold their shape and color for years.
They’re also a solid choice for allergy-conscious homeowners, as they don’t trap dust and pollen the way curtains or fabric shades do.
Easy to Clean and Maintain
Forget about vacuum attachments or fabric steamer routines. Shutters are among the easiest window treatments to maintain, needing just a quick dusting or wipe with a damp cloth. This low-maintenance appeal is especially valuable in bedrooms, where cleanliness and air quality matter most.

FAQs
Can shutters be painted or stained to match my bedroom furniture?
Yes, many shutters are available in a wide range of finishes, and some can be custom-painted or stained to complement your bedroom’s color palette or furnishings. You can review available samples during your consultation to ensure a cohesive look.
How are shutters installed on different types of bedroom windows?
Shutters, including casement, double-hung, and even uniquely shaped frames, can be customized for nearly any window style. A professional will take precise measurements to ensure a seamless fit and proper function with your existing window hardware.
Do shutters work well with blackout requirements?
While standard shutters do not entirely block out light, they block significantly more light than most fabric or slatted options, especially when installed inside the frame. Combining shutters with blackout side panels or drapery can be an effective solution for bedrooms requiring complete darkness.
